Nato Green, stand-up comedian and political comic known for sharp tour sets, joins to chat about his upcoming album and warm-up shows. They react to a March 1893 newspaper: gossip about high-society photos, praise-for-cocaine passages, a man selling his body for dissection, and bizarre items like igniting telegraph boys and suspended electric car ideas.

INSIGHT

Cocaine: From Allure To Recognized Harm

  • The 1893 article treats cocaine as an alluring, socially accepted narcotic while also warning of rapid addiction and mental decline.
  • Hosts map that tension to modern drug marketing and prescription ad-style messaging, exposing how acceptance shifts before harms are visible.
